My Buying Guides on Pots And Pans Shelving

Why I Look for Pots and Pans Shelving

When I shop for pots and pans shelving, I want something that helps me keep my kitchen organized, saves space, and makes cooking easier. The right shelving can turn a cluttered cabinet or countertop into a neat, practical storage area. I also look for shelving that lets me grab what I need quickly without digging through stacked cookware.

Types of Pots and Pans Shelving I Consider

I usually compare a few common styles before I buy:

  • Wall-mounted shelving: Great when I want to free up cabinet space and keep cookware visible.
  • Freestanding racks: Best for renters or anyone who wants a flexible setup.
  • Under-cabinet shelving: Useful when I need to make the most of unused space.
  • Pull-out shelving: Ideal for easy access, especially in deep cabinets.
  • Corner shelving: Helpful if I want to use awkward kitchen corners efficiently.

Material Matters to Me

The material is one of the first things I check because it affects durability and appearance. I usually look for:

  • Stainless steel: Strong, modern-looking, and resistant to rust.
  • Chrome-plated metal: Affordable and easy to clean.
  • Wood: Attractive and warm-looking, though it may need more care.
  • Heavy-duty plastic: Lightweight and budget-friendly, but not always as durable.

For me, stainless steel is often the safest choice if I want long-lasting performance.

Size and Space Planning

Before buying, I always measure the space where I plan to place the shelving. I check the width, height, and depth so I know the rack will fit properly. I also think about the size of my pots and pans. If I store large stockpots or wide skillets, I need shelving with enough clearance and strong support.

Weight Capacity Is Important

I never ignore weight capacity because cookware can get heavy fast. A shelf that looks sturdy may still sag if it is not built for heavy pots and pans. I prefer shelving that clearly lists its maximum load so I can feel confident it will hold everything safely.

Installation and Ease of Use

I like shelving that is simple to install and easy to use every day. If I am buying wall-mounted or under-cabinet shelving, I check whether it comes with the necessary hardware and clear instructions. I also consider whether I can remove or adjust it later if my kitchen needs change.

Design and Accessibility

A good shelving system should make my cookware easier to reach, not harder. I prefer designs that keep items visible and organized. Adjustable shelves are especially helpful because I can change the spacing depending on the size of my pans and lids.

Cleaning and Maintenance

I look for shelving that is easy to wipe down because kitchens can get greasy and dusty. Smooth metal finishes are usually easier for me to maintain than materials with lots of grooves or decorative details. If I choose wood, I make sure I am comfortable with the extra care it may need.

Budget and Value

I try to balance price with quality. A cheaper shelf may seem appealing, but if it bends or rusts quickly, I end up replacing it sooner. I usually prefer to spend a little more on something durable and practical because it gives me better value over time.
